summaryrefslogtreecommitdiff
path: root/src/mongo/db/pipeline/document_source_group.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/mongo/db/pipeline/document_source_group.cpp')
-rw-r--r--src/mongo/db/pipeline/document_source_group.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/mongo/db/pipeline/document_source_group.cpp b/src/mongo/db/pipeline/document_source_group.cpp
index c4ca7bc932f..a92a05386c5 100644
--- a/src/mongo/db/pipeline/document_source_group.cpp
+++ b/src/mongo/db/pipeline/document_source_group.cpp
@@ -749,7 +749,7 @@ Document DocumentSourceGroup::makeDocument(const Value& id,
// we return null in this case so return objects are predictable
out.addField(_accumulatedFields[i].fieldName, Value(BSONNULL));
} else {
- out.addField(_accumulatedFields[i].fieldName, val);
+ out.addField(_accumulatedFields[i].fieldName, std::move(val));
}
}